2026 Global Human Capital Trends

Deloitte · 30 April 2026

Learning & Performance. Four Corners commentary on a source published by Deloitte.

Deloitte's 2026 research draws on 9,000 leaders across 76 countries and explores how organisations are responding to changes in work, technology, skills and organisational performance.

Key finding / idea

Only 8% of respondents described their traditional change management and learning efforts as highly effective in helping their workforce remain relevant.

Why we picked it

This feels particularly relevant to our September conversation. Organisations invest heavily in programmes designed to change skills and behaviour. But the uncomfortable question is whether the programme itself is always the right intervention. The finding doesn't tell us to stop investing in learning. It gives us a good reason to question how quickly we reach for a programme as the solution.

A question worth considering

Are we too quick to diagnose organisational problems as learning problems?
